BSNL Bars ISD for Prepaid Connections

BSNL has officially announced that international callings will be pre-deactivated on all new prepaid connections as per TRAI directives. Existing prepaid customers will be informed via SMS regarding this. But best part is those who like to continue enjoying ISD services, can easily activate ISD services by sending SMS. Just send 'ACT ISD' to 53733. To deactivate send 'DEACT ISD' to 53733 Read More

Tata Docomo Launches 2G New Year Data Pack With Data Benefits of 2013 MB

Tata Docomo has come up with a new attractive 2G Data Pack for its prepaid subscribers priced at Rs 46 the pack will offer data benefits of 2013 MB which will be valid 5 days. The 2G data pack will be available only through electronic recharges for GSM customers in Karnataka the data pack will be available to the customers till 3rd January 2013.
